Bullish Walcott ready for tough run
Six games in the next 18 days, including showdowns with Chelsea, Sp*rs and Manchester United, two Champions League fixtures and a visit to high-flying Leicester…Arsenal's season is about to kick into overdrive. Having recovered from sloppy dropped points against West Ham and Liverpool to grind our way back into the Premier League's top four it's essential we maintain steady momentum. According to Theo Walcott, it'll be tough, however, he assures supporters there's a belief in the squad that the club can challenge on three fronts in the run up to Christmas.
